Output dabddea0db4832a60e698b5cec66023825a5bb35b8ac51ec3f3f16fe1f8a466e:0

value
51400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58431e9864ff6320d4ea9e0cd4ba4fa5438e20ba OP_EQUAL
address
MFwr6reSrsMGyAo9y2UAbZWFncEueLR2qQ
transaction
dabddea0db4832a60e698b5cec66023825a5bb35b8ac51ec3f3f16fe1f8a466e
spent
true